Output 588b1b0763f4f745d4116863ba4a4b4e454aa79ba00e3ffe859ff210ae404c03:43

value
1031592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86308b7048a6c6763b1f99cf92f5f14da7f82651 OP_EQUAL
address
3DvYdC8QCBENNMnLz565dAygib8pNsxSCg
transaction
588b1b0763f4f745d4116863ba4a4b4e454aa79ba00e3ffe859ff210ae404c03
spent
true